How to Take Care of a Robot Mop and Vacuum

A robot vacuum and mop will save you time when cleaning. They also require regular maintenance such as emptying the dustbins, cleaning the reusable cleaning pads in conformity with the manufacturer's guidelines, or removing the single-use ones and maintaining the sensors clean.

Look for mapping features to avoid making repeated passes over the same areas and also app integration to create schedules, modify power settings and modes and save maps of your home.

1. Empty the Dirt Bin

Most robot mops and vacuum cleaners require regular maintenance, including emptying the dirt bins, washing pads, and keeping track of replacement consumables. The better you maintain these components, the longer they'll last. Some cleaning machines require a little extra care in particular those with water tanks.

First, make sure the dirty dustbin is completely emptied after each cleaning session. This is among the easiest tasks you can complete, yet it is vital for the smooth operation of your robot. You should also make sure to clean your filter regularly. Refer to the user's manual to determine how and when you should clean your filters.

2. The Cleaning Pads


Depending on the way you utilize your robot mop the pads may be stained or dirty. It's important to wash the cleaning pads regularly. You can wash them by hand or in the washer alongside your normal laundry. Avoid using fabric softeners and dryer sheets as they will reduce the absorbency and cause the pad to not function properly.

If your robot mop is also a vacuum cleaner, then you must empty and clean its dust bin regularly. This is also true for hybrid models that combine sweep and vacuum with dry mop pads. Many robot mops come with brush attachments that must be cleaned.

It is recommended to wash the mop pads thoroughly to remove any dirt and grime. You can also soak the pads in warm water to get rid of any debris that has remained. Once they're clean, let the pads air dry or place them in the dryer at a low heat setting. It's recommended that you wash the pads every 2-3 months.

4. Clean the Sensors

The majority of robot vacuums as well as mop-and-vacuum combo models have an app that lets you set up automatic cleaning schedules, set cleaning modes and monitor when the device requires maintenance. The app lets you manually clean, start, stop and change your robot's settings from anywhere in the house.

The app is particularly useful if your robotic cleaner has mapping features, like cameras, lasers or optical dToF, which allow it to save an image of the room as well as navigate around furniture. These features can also reduce the frequency of recurring stains on your floor, making your cleaning chores less labor intensive.

If the sensor for your robot's mapping gets dirty, it could be unable to navigate around your home. Cleaning these sensors is crucial as is cleaning the screen of a smartphone or camera lens. This is best done with a dry and clean cloth. If you use a moist cloth or cleaner, you could harm the sensors which could cause them to malfunction.

Also, it's recommended to clean the brushes on your robot vacuum regularly. This will stop hair tangles and tangles from clogging up the motor and make it easier for your robot to remove debris. It's also an excellent idea to clean down the primary brush roll since it is responsible for removing dirt and can accumulate a lot of dust over the course of time.

Also, make sure you only use the cleaning products suggested by the manufacturer of your robot. Other floor cleaners could damage your robot and invalidate the warranty. Most brands recommend a mix of water and vinegar or an approved cleaning solution formulated specifically for their robot. Never use hot water or abrasive cleaners because they can damage the internal components of your robot cleaner, and leave the floor soiled. Check out the owner's manual for more detailed instructions on how to clean your robot cleaner. This will ensure that it works efficiently and lasts for a longer time.
